I. Have a master craftsman 101.07382 lathe. I am pretty sure the headstock has been changed because everything I find about that lathe says it has timken bearings but in fact has babbit bearings. I am installing a 3/4 hp. Variable a.c. motor and want to know the approx max spindle rpm so I can setup accordingly. Any ideas? Thanks in advance

Looks like babbit to me. Model A Fords had babbitt bearings too and used shims for adjustment. If you keep the babbitt
bearings well oiled on the lathe, it will last a long long time. My older lathe has drip oilers and I turn them on when using
the lathe. I have used it a lot and have never had to reshim the bearings in twenty years. Your bearings look fine. I wouldn't
worry too much about overspeeding the lathe, just keep it oiled well and put your hand on the bearing cap to verify that they
are just warm to the touch during a run. That's a nice looking vintage Craftsman lathe, probably very early production unit.
 
I have PDF versions of the 1936 and 1939 Sears Tool Catalogs. Both have lathes similar to yours with Babbitt bearings in the headstocks. It's hard to believe, but both machines are advertised as having a top speed of 2,100 rpm. These are large catalogs with the 1936 version being nearly 9MB and the 1939 version being nearly 25MB. When you think about it, automotive shell bearings turn can turn upwards of 10k RPM. Pretty similar construction. As long as it has an oil film between the spindle and bearings life is good. Mike
 
The auto bearings have a pressure oil pump system. that's the key to high RPM. Today's car engines use an insert that's really just a way to get away from casting babbit.

Condition of the bearing and oiling amount, will determine your max RPM. Another trick is to loosen the cap bolts when running fast. A guess here, but if you optimize all this, you could do 2000 for short runs.
